WebApr 17, 2024 · Fact Sheets are prepared for substances on the New Jersey Right to Know Hazardous Substance List. More than 2,000 Fact Sheets have been completed and more than 900 have been translated into Spanish.

WebApr 4, 2024 · Community Right-to-Know Requirements (40 CFR Part 370) - Facilities handling or storing any hazardous chemicals must submit Safety Data Sheets (SDS) [formerly known as Material Safety Data Sheets (MSDSs)] to their SERC or TERC, LEPC or TEPC, and local fire department.
